MKT Depot Museum

Katy, Texas

General, History

The MKT Depot was built in 1898 and enlarged in 1919. The Katy Heritage Society was formed in 1979 to save the depot from being destroyed; and had continued it's mission to preserve local history since that time. The Depot has been restored as a working MKT Depot. Colors were carefully researched and the building looks much like it did while in the early years of service. The Museum includes exhibits of local and MKT history and a freight room furnished as if busy around the turn of the century. The City of Katy operates a visitors center out of the depot, information about the Katy area and the Katy Heritage Society is avialable.

Katy Heritage Park was created in 2003 with a partnership between the KHS and the City of Katy. The Katy Heritage Society still owns and operates and is financially responsible for the properties. It's a great community venue, large lawn area for picnics and games, big pavilion for gathering, 5 buildings all connected by curving pavestone walkways lined with old fashioned street lights. We had over 1000 people come out for the lighting of our Christmas tree and it's our hope it will continue to be a destination for community events. We have one house that is used for public meetings and can be rented for private parties.
